I think you're right there Adam. I know the earlier cars didn't have side repeaters, and that they had the computer and the tweed seats but I didn't know about the stripes.
The one we have is an 86' spec car (even though its an 85 car
) and it has no computer (yet
) and the mk2 CX GTi velour on the seats.
It also has a black dash. For a mk1, I think thats vital as its the only one which doesn't go multi-coloured
